#374065 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#374065 is composed of 21.6% red, 25.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 228.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 30.6%. #374065 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e80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#374065 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#374065 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#374065 has RGB values of R:55, G:64,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3620965.

Shades and Tints of #374065
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07080c is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#374065
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494b53 is the less saturated color, while #011f9b is the most saturated one.
